Why Convert PDF to JPEG?

A PDF is a fixed-layout document, which makes it awkward to post on social media, drop into a slideshow or preview in chat apps. Converting to JPEG renders the first page of your PDF as a sharp image that opens anywhere — no PDF reader needed. Upload several PDFs to convert them in one batch.
